Rotuma is a
Fijian dependency, consisting of Rotuma Island and nearby islets. The island group is home to a small but unique indigenous
ethnic group which constitutes a recognisable minority within the population of Fiji, known as "
Rotumans". Its population at the 2007
census was 2,002, although many more Rotumans live on mainland Fijian islands, totaling 10,000.
